Mining and extraction

sole

The seat or bottom of a mine; applied to horizontal veins or lodes.

sole: the floor of a horizontal mineral deposit

In hard rock mining, the sole is the lower boundary surface of a horizontal or gently dipping ore body, where the mineralized rock meets the unmineralized country rock beneath it. It is the floor of the lode. The term applies primarily to vein deposits and stratiform ore bodies that run roughly parallel to the bedding or foliation of the surrounding rock, distinguishing it from steeply inclined or vertical veins where such terminology becomes less useful.

The sole is critically important to underground mining because it defines the lower limit of profitable extraction. Mining engineers must determine whether the sole is a clean, sharp contact or a gradational boundary where mineralization fades into barren rock. A sharp sole makes it easier to stop extraction at a defined depth and avoid dilution, whereas a gradational sole forces difficult decisions about cutoff grades and increases waste handling costs.

Recognition and mapping

Identifying the sole requires geological mapping and drill core logging. Experienced miners and geologists read the lithology, assay results, and structural attitude of the deposit to pinpoint where ore grades drop below economic thresholds. The sole's position may vary across the length of a lode, dipping or rising in response to folding, faulting, or original depositional patterns. Surface geology and diamond drilling programs establish the sole's location before extraction begins and during mining as conditions are reassessed.

The term contrasts with the hanging wall, which is the rock above the lode. Together, the sole and hanging wall frame the ore body between them. In collieries and coal mining, comparable language applies, though coal seams often receive more specialized terminology. The sole's exact definition depends on whether the operation uses geological boundaries, grade cutoffs, or both to mark the limit of extraction.

Proper recognition of the sole prevents overextraction of waste rock that would dilute ore quality and raise processing costs. Poor sole definition has historically led to significant economic losses in underground operations, making geological competence in identifying it a core skill for mining production teams.
